成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

Pandas完成在線文件和剪切板數(shù)據(jù)讀取詳細(xì)說(shuō)明

89542767 / 560人閱讀

  文中關(guān)鍵給大家介紹是指Pandas二種少使用的讀取文件方式:載入在線文件的信息和載入剪切板的信息,感興趣的朋友能夠來(lái)了解一下吧一塊兒學(xué)習(xí)下


  序言


  小伙伴們好,我就是Peter~


  文中記載的是Pandas二種少使用的讀取文件方式:

  載入在線文件的信息
  載入剪切板的信息
  申明:文中案例和在線數(shù)據(jù)僅限于學(xué)術(shù)研究共享
  read_html
  該函數(shù)公式表示是立即載入線上的html文件,一般都是圖表形式;將HTML的表格轉(zhuǎn)換為DataFrame的1種迅速方便快捷的方式。
  用這種方法針對(duì)迅速合拼來(lái)自各式各樣網(wǎng)頁(yè)頁(yè)面里的報(bào)表非常有利,就免去了抓取數(shù)據(jù)信息再去載入的時(shí)間也。
  實(shí)際函數(shù)的參數(shù)為:
  pandas.read_html(io,#文件io對(duì)象;路徑或者io.Strings對(duì)象
  match='.+',#str或編譯的正則表達(dá)式,可選
  flavor=None,#要使用的解析引擎,None是默認(rèn)值
  header=None,#文件表頭
  index_col=None,#索引
  skiprows=None,#跳過(guò)行
  attrs=None,#屬性
  parse_dates=False,#日期解析
  thousands=',',#千分位
  encoding=None,#編碼
  decimal='.',#識(shí)別為小數(shù)點(diǎn)的字符
  converters=None,#屬性轉(zhuǎn)換
  na_values=None,#空值信息
  keep_default_na=True,#是否保持空值
  displayed_only=True#是否應(yīng)該解析帶有“display:none”的元素
  )
  在線文件1
  讀取維基百科上一份歷屆奧運(yùn)會(huì)乒乓球冠軍的相關(guān)數(shù)據(jù)。該地址下的部分表格形式的數(shù)據(jù):
  In[3]:
  url="https://zh.m.wikipedia.org/zh/%E5%A5%A5%E6%9E%97%E5%8C%B9%E5%85%8B%E8%BF%90%E5%8A%A8%E4%BC%9A%E4%B  
  df=pd.read_html(url)
  df 9%92%E4%B9%93%E7%90%83%E5%A5%96%E7%89%8C%E5%BE%97%E4%B8%BB%E5%88%97%E8%A1%A8"
  df=pd.read_html(url)
  df
  Out[3]:
  我們觀察到此時(shí)讀取到的df是一個(gè)列表,總長(zhǎng)度是15
 list
  In[4]:
   len(df)
  Out[4]:
  9
  查看列表中的部分元素:此時(shí)就是一個(gè)個(gè)的DataFrame形式的數(shù)據(jù)
  在線文件2
  一個(gè)國(guó)外網(wǎng)站下的數(shù)據(jù)
  In[7]:
  df1=pd.read_html("https://www.fdic.gov/resources/resolutions/bank-failures/failed-bank-list")
  type(df1)
  Out[7]:
  list
  In[8]:
  len(df1)
  In[9]:
  df1[0]
  Out[9]:
  讀取在線CSV文件
  以讀取GitHub上一個(gè)CSV文件為例:
  方式1:直接讀取

  url="https://raw.githubusercontent.com/cs109/2014_data/master/countries.csv"


  pd.read_csv(url)


  方式2:通過(guò)io.Strings對(duì)象


  url="https://raw.githubusercontent.com/cs109/2014_data/master/countries.csv"
  response=requests.get(url).content#先發(fā)請(qǐng)求
  df2=pd.read_csv(io.StringIO(response.decode('utf-8')))
  df2#效果同上
  Pandas讀取剪貼板
  pandas.read_clipboard(sep='s+',**kwargs)


  官網(wǎng)地址


  一個(gè)簡(jiǎn)單的例子說(shuō)明函數(shù)使用:假設(shè)本地目錄下有這樣Excel表格的數(shù)據(jù)


  1、先剪貼數(shù)據(jù):【Ctrl+C】


  2、運(yùn)行代碼下面的代碼,按下MacOS中的【向上的箭頭】+【回車(chē)鍵】,完成讀取


  Windows下面應(yīng)該是【Shift+Enter】


  如果數(shù)據(jù)比較少,省去了通過(guò)Excel或者CSV文件的讀取方式的時(shí)間:


  綜上所述,這篇文章就給大家介紹到這里了,希望可以給大家?guī)?lái)幫助。

文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/128736.html

相關(guān)文章

  • 如何利用python在剪貼讀取/寫(xiě)入數(shù)據(jù)

      小編寫(xiě)這篇文章的主要目的,主要給大家講解一些關(guān)于python的一些小技巧,比如說(shuō)使用python去進(jìn)行讀取和寫(xiě)入數(shù)據(jù),那么,這些數(shù)據(jù)怎么在剪貼板上去進(jìn)行相關(guān)的處理呢,下面就跟著小編的步伐,去了解一下具體內(nèi)容吧?! ∽x取剪貼板上的數(shù)據(jù)  先給大家介紹pandas.read_clipboard,從剪貼板讀取文本并傳遞到Read_csv?! andas.read_clipboard(sep=...

    89542767 評(píng)論0 收藏0
  • js拖拽粘貼上傳與CodeMirror

    摘要:屬性介紹默認(rèn)是默認(rèn)是在粘貼操作時(shí)為空剪切板中的各項(xiàng)數(shù)據(jù)剪切板中的數(shù)據(jù)類型。避免重復(fù)創(chuàng)建上傳中文件成功失敗處理已上傳上傳出錯(cuò)添加文件到隊(duì)列并上傳開(kāi)始上傳其他參考獲取剪切板內(nèi)容,控制圖片粘貼在線代碼編輯器事件說(shuō)明 Markdown編輯器選用https://simplemde.com它是一款純js實(shí)現(xiàn)的markdown編輯器。缺點(diǎn)不支持圖片上傳。那我們就得改造它。simplemde是基于co...

    FullStackDeveloper 評(píng)論0 收藏0
  • 剪切粘貼上傳圖片功能的javascript實(shí)現(xiàn)

    摘要:平時(shí)的開(kāi)發(fā)中我們難免要上傳一些網(wǎng)頁(yè)截圖圖片等,傳統(tǒng)的選擇文件上傳使用起來(lái)不方便,這里介紹一種使用和實(shí)現(xiàn)的剪切板黏貼上傳圖片功能。剪切板中圖片的獲取與上傳通過(guò),我們可以以的形式獲取到剪切板中的圖片,然后將數(shù)據(jù)作為參數(shù)通過(guò)的方式傳輸?shù)椒?wù)器端。 平時(shí)的開(kāi)發(fā)中我們難免要上傳一些網(wǎng)頁(yè)截圖、圖片等,傳統(tǒng)的選擇文件上傳使用起來(lái)不方便,這里介紹一種使用js和node實(shí)現(xiàn)的剪切板黏貼上傳圖片功能。當(dāng)我...

    anyway 評(píng)論0 收藏0
  • HeyUI組件庫(kù)按需加載功能上線,盤(pán)點(diǎn)HeyUI組件庫(kù)有哪些獨(dú)特功能?

    摘要:測(cè)試復(fù)制至剪切板的文本測(cè)試相關(guān)文檔復(fù)制剪切板滾動(dòng)至視圖內(nèi)其實(shí),這是一個(gè)非常方便的功能,比如說(shuō),分頁(yè)加載后滾動(dòng)至頭部,切換頁(yè)面時(shí)切換至頭部。HeyUI組件庫(kù) 如果你還不了解heyui組件庫(kù),歡迎來(lái)我們的官網(wǎng)或者github參觀。 官網(wǎng) github 當(dāng)然,如果能給我們一顆???,那是最贊的了! 按需加載 當(dāng)heyui組件庫(kù)的組件越來(lái)越多的時(shí)候,按需加載的功能終于上線了。 話不多說(shuō),先把按需...

    IamDLY 評(píng)論0 收藏0
  • js獲取剪切內(nèi)容,js控制圖片粘貼。

    摘要:在用戶執(zhí)行粘貼操作的時(shí)候,能夠獲得剪切板的內(nèi)容,本文討論一下這個(gè)問(wèn)題。目前只有支持獲取剪切板中的圖片數(shù)據(jù)。這么多的判斷條件,基本可以確定通過(guò)剪切板過(guò)來(lái)的是粘貼的文件。 在用戶執(zhí)行粘貼操作的時(shí)候,js能夠獲得剪切板的內(nèi)容,本文討論一下這個(gè)問(wèn)題。 目前只有Chrome支持獲取剪切板中的圖片數(shù)據(jù)。還好需要這個(gè)功能的產(chǎn)品目前只支持Chrome和Safari,一些Chrome的新特性是可以盡情使...

    KaltZK 評(píng)論0 收藏0

發(fā)表評(píng)論

0條評(píng)論

最新活動(dòng)
閱讀需要支付1元查看
<